| Obverse description | Laureate head of Zeus facing right, rendered in high relief with finely detailed hair and beard flowing in thick, naturalistic locks. The laurel wreath is depicted with individual leaves curving backward from the brow. The portrait displays the powerful, mature physiognomy characteristic of Hellenistic representations of Zeus, with pronounced facial features and a broad neck. The field is bordered by a dotted bead ring. |

| Reverse description | Europa, the mythological Phoenician princess, seated side-saddle and riding a bull striding to the right, a type intimately associated with the coinage of Gortyna in Crete. The figure of Europa is depicted with flowing drapery, and the composition fills the coin field dynamically. A Greek inscription appears in the left and lower fields, identifying the issuing city. The entire design is enclosed within a bead ring border. |
